## Flintbird UI — Snapshot Testing Environments

Welcome aboard! Snapshot tests for Flintbird components run in the `vistest` environment, which pins fonts and viewport sizes so renders stay deterministic. If snapshots churn on your machine, you're probably not using the pinned renderer. CI regenerates baselines only on tagged commits — don't commit local ones. The snapshot runner picks up its settings from the following configuration.

config for kafof-bawef:
holath:
  log_level: debug
  metrics_host: metrics.holath.qorvelsys.internal
  pin: 2191
  pool_size: 32

Night shift: evacuation-chair store on Stairwell C, Level 3, was restocked today. Two Havermont chairs serviced, one sent to Drayle Safety for repair. Check the seal on the store door at 02:00 rounds. If the seal is broken, log it and re-secure. Door access for the store uses the pass below.

staff pass of fajop-kajop = bdg-H-83

Action item from the Mirewater tide-table widget incident. Owner: release manager. Widget cached stale harbor offsets after the DST change, showing tides six hours off for two days. Required: add a cache-invalidation check to the release checklist, block deploys when offset tables are older than 24 hours, and verify the Saltgate harbor feed before each cut. Deadline: next release. Checklist template and sign-off procedure are documented on the internal page below.

wiki page, kawif-bajep: https://artifactory.zarqelforge.internal/issue/browse/display/display/projects/spaces/secrets/000fe6ec5a46af29355003e1

Alert: Sieveline sampler dropping above threshold. The Bramblecast service is emitting logs faster than the sampler's configured ceiling, so non-error lines are being discarded aggressively. Error visibility is preserved, but debugging context may be thin. Check recent traffic spikes or config pushes before escalating. Triage steps are on the internal page here:

runbook for kawef-hahif: https://jira.lumicsys.internal/projects/browse/display/c08d703c